First time post to this group, but I've been following it for a long time. I'm blown away by the quality of the work from the modelers here.

Here are some pics of my Myers Manx. Built pretty much box stock, but I added some engine wiring, seat belts and instruments. Paint is Testors One-Step Lime Ice with One-Step Clear. The paint is great, but the metal flakes would be a bit big for my taste for anything but a dune buggy or a bass boat.

Comments, good and bad, are welcome. Thanks for looking.
